VSO is a charity that works through skilled, professional volunteers, who spend up to two years working with organisations across the poorest countries in Africa and Asia. Accenture have been working in partnership with VSO since 1999.

I have decided to support VSO again this year and I am asking you to support this organisation and specifically the work that it is doing on HIV and Aids in Africa. eg: In Zambia, VSO volunteer Charles Kalameera divides his time between 5 organisations helping to establish income generating activities for people living with HIV and Aids so that they can support themselves.

About the charity

VSO is an international development organisation that brings people together to share skills, build capabilities, and change lives to make the world a fairer place for all. Everyday, VSO volunteers are working to empower people living in some of the world’s most marginalised communities.
